What Are Tech Competitions and How Can You Find the Right One to Enter?

Written by admin

As technology continues to shape the modern world, tech competitions have become increasingly popular among students, professionals, entrepreneurs, and technology enthusiasts. These events provide opportunities to showcase skills, solve real-world problems, collaborate with like-minded individuals, and gain recognition within the industry. Whether you’re interested in coding,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, robotics, or innovation, entering the right competition can help accelerate both your personal and professional development.

Understanding Tech Competitions

Tech competitions are organised events that challenge participants to apply their technical knowledge, creativity, and problem-solving abilities. They often focus on developing innovative solutions, building software applications, creating hardware projects, or tackling industry-specific challenges.

Competitions can be hosted by universities, technology companies, government organisations, startups, and non-profit groups. Many are designed to encourage innovation while helping participants gain practical experience outside of traditional educational or workplace environments.

Common Types of Tech Competitions

There are many different forms of technology-focused contests, each catering to specific interests and skill sets.

Hackathons

Hackathons typically bring participants together for a limited period, often between 24 and 72 hours, to develop software, hardware, or digital solutions around a particular theme or challenge.

Coding Competitions

These events focus on programming and algorithmic problem-solving. Participants compete to solve technical challenges quickly and efficiently using various programming languages.

Cybersecurity Challenges

Often referred to as Capture the Flag (CTF) competitions, these events test participants’ abilities to identify vulnerabilities, secure systems, and solve security-related puzzles.

Robotics Competitions

Robotics events require teams to design, build, and programme robots capable of completing specific tasks or competing against other robotic systems.

Innovation and Startup Challenges

These competitions encourage participants to develop business ideas, products, or services that solve practical problems and present them to judges or potential investors.

Benefits of Participating in Tech Competitions

Taking part in technology competitions offers numerous advantages beyond the possibility of winning prizes.

Skill Development

Competitions provide hands-on experience that helps participants strengthen technical skills, critical thinking, and project management abilities.

Networking Opportunities

Many events attract industry professionals, recruiters, mentors, and fellow technology enthusiasts, creating valuable networking opportunities.

Portfolio Building

Projects developed during competitions can become impressive additions to a professional portfolio, helping demonstrate practical experience to employers or clients.

Career Advancement

Success in recognised competitions can enhance a CV, strengthen university applications, and even lead directly to internships or job opportunities.

Recognition and Rewards

Many competitions offer cash prizes, scholarships, mentorship programmes, software licences, and other incentives for top performers.

How to Choose the Right Tech Competition

With so many opportunities available, selecting the most suitable competition is important.

Consider Your Interests

Focus on competitions that align with your passion and long-term goals. If you enjoy software development, coding competitions and hackathons may be ideal. If you are interested in engineering, robotics contests may be a better fit.

Assess Your Experience Level

Some competitions are designed for beginners, while others target experienced professionals. Choosing an event that matches your current abilities can help you gain the most value from the experience.

Review the Competition Format

Before entering, take time to understand the rules, judging criteria, deadlines, and team requirements. This ensures you know exactly what to expect.

Evaluate the Potential Benefits

Consider what you hope to gain from participating, whether that is learning new skills, networking, building a portfolio, or competing for prizes.

Where to Find Tech Competitions

Finding opportunities to enter is easier than ever thanks to a variety of online and offline resources.

Online Competition Platforms

Many websites specialise in listing upcoming technology events, hackathons, coding challenges, and innovation contests from around the world.

Universities and Educational Institutions

Colleges and universities frequently organise competitions for students and often promote external opportunities through technology departments and student societies.

Industry Events and Conferences

Technology conferences, trade shows, and networking events often feature competitions or provide information about upcoming opportunities.

Professional Communities

Online forums, social media groups, developer communities, and technology-focused platforms regularly share information about new competitions and challenges.
